B. Fugiel is a scholar working on Materials Chemistry, Electronic, Optical and Magnetic Materials and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, B. Fugiel has authored 55 papers receiving a total of 416 indexed citations (citations by other indexed papers that have themselves been cited), including 48 papers in Materials Chemistry, 25 papers in Electronic, Optical and Magnetic Materials and 19 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in B. Fugiel's work include Solid-state spectroscopy and crystallography (41 papers), Nonlinear Optical Materials Research (15 papers) and Spectroscopy and Quantum Chemical Studies (13 papers). B. Fugiel is often cited by papers focused on Solid-state spectroscopy and crystallography (41 papers), Nonlinear Optical Materials Research (15 papers) and Spectroscopy and Quantum Chemical Studies (13 papers). B. Fugiel collaborates with scholars based in Poland, Czechia and Japan. B. Fugiel's co-authors include B. Westwański, M. Mierzwa, J. Zioło, Toshio Kikuta, A. Chełkowski, Francisco Javier Romero, J. Del Cerro, Toshinari Yamazaki, M. C. Gallardo and Takuya Yamazaki and has published in prestigious journals such as Physical review. B, Condensed matter, Journal of Physics Condensed Matter and Physics Letters A.
